Output 59cd31af07124cecbc44a8d556e93f2a226388f2f75fb325bd41feb7a28e0c63:0

value
49068056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ade73a15534ea69aca35c9bca8e413ac2bd366ee OP_EQUAL
address
3HYXpf1rQVCDi9AkXTG9TbSc6pJai8dxuY
transaction
59cd31af07124cecbc44a8d556e93f2a226388f2f75fb325bd41feb7a28e0c63
confirmations
309168
spent
true